Position Type Full-Time/Regular Boston University Virtual (BUV) is a unit at Boston University focused on the creation of high-quality online degree and certificate programs. Reporting to the Assistant Vice President, Digital Architecture and Technology Platforms, the Educational Technology Innovation Specialist will play a pivotal role working across BUV and Boston University to leverage educational technology to enable a world-class, global online student experience. The Educational Technology Innovation Specialist is a forward-thinking professional dedicated to enhancing the learning experience across the BU Virtual online program portfolio through strategic use of emerging educational technologies. This role is ideal for a creative and analytical technologist who thrives on experimentation, is deeply familiar with the higher education learning technology ecosystem, and can deliver scalable, sustainable solutions that improve teaching, learning, and student engagement. Working across a broad matrixed environment and in close collaboration with faculty, academic leadership, instructional designers, operations specialists and central IS&T, the Educational Technology Innovation Specialist will evaluate the learning experience ecosystem to leverage existing tools and identify emerging tools necessary for engaging online students in a remote setting. This role will work closely with stakeholders to expose technology features, configure templates for efficiency and standardization across programs, and ensure that tools are integrated into the ecosystem to allow for a seamless student experience. This role will be responsible for monitoring tool usage, build business justifications for new tools, and maintain the strategic roadmap used to drive strategic learning experience investments. Key Responsibilities: Technology Innovation and Experimentation:
Research, evaluate, and pilot new and emerging educational technology tools, platforms, and approaches
Identify opportunities to apply innovations that enhance pedagogy, accessibility, and learner engagement
Foster culture of experimentation, prototyping, and iteration Learning Experience Enhancement:
Collaborate with faculty, instructional designers, and academic leadership to integrate technology solutions that align with curricular goals
Develop and deliver templates, frameworks, and toolkits to enable scalable adoption of new technologies
Provide consultation and support for course design and delivery in online and hybrid environments Ecosystem Integration and Optimization:
Maintain a strong understanding of institutional learning technology ecosystem (ex: LMS, SIS, assessment, proctoring, collaboration, engagement, and badging tools)
Ensure new tools integrate effectively into broader technology landscape, meeting standards for data security, accessibility, and compliance
Partner with central IS&T, academic technology, and faculty development teams to streamline workflows and processes and ensure tool training is available to maximize features and functions Scalability and Continuous Improvement:
Build reusable models and templates for course design, assessment, and student engagement that can be applied across the online portfolio
Collect and analyze data on tool adoption and impact to inform continuous improvement
Contribute to governance and strategic planning processes for educational technology across BU Virtual and BU
Required Skills
Bachelor's degree required; master's in education, Instructional technology, learning design or related IT field preferred.
3-5 years of experience supporting academic technology, either in educational technology, instructional design, or digital learning environments in higher education.
Proven ability to evaluate and implement emerging tools in online and hybrid learning contexts.
Strong knowledge of content management systems, learning management systems, and related academic technology ecosystems.
Excellent communications, collaboration, and project management skills
Ability to balance innovation and scalability, sustainability and institutional alignment.
